I am unable to specify Local Folder, so I can't download the books for offline use :-(

Steps:

  1. Open application
  2. Hamburger --> Local Media
  3. Select "Books" (or "Podcasts") and tap on "New Folder"
  4. ... Nothing happens... :-(

The application has appropriate rights to media files.

Tested with versions: 0.9.56-beta and 0.9.57-beta

Mobiles: OnePlus 8 Pro and OnePlus 9 Pro
LineageOS: 18.1 and 19.1 respectfully.

Ok. Figured out why.
I use MiXplorer exclusively and I disable "Files" app completely. When there is no "Files" app Audiobookshelf cannot call it to pick the local folder.
